Ethical Hacking Training Syllabus
- What is Ethical Hacking?
- Threat Landscape Overview
- Cyber Kill Chain & MITRE ATT&CK Basics
- Security Policies and Standards (ISO, NIST,GDPR)
- Lab Setup: Kali Linux, Parrot OS, VirtualBox, Burp Suite Community
- Tools: Nmap, Netcat
- OSI and TCP/IP Models
- Network Topologies - Bus Network, Star Network, Ring Network, Mesh Network
- Common Network Devices
- Layer 3 - IP addresses, IP headers, Subnets, Subnet masks, Class A,B& C subnets, Private & Public IP addresses
- Layer 2 - ARP, RARP, ICMP
- Layer 4 - TCP, 3-way handshake, UDP
- DNS, DHCP, ARP Basics
- Lab Setup: Wireshark Network Monitoring
- Tools: Wireshark, Tcpdump
- Port and Service Scanning
- Vulnerability
- Banner Grabbing and OS Detection
- Enumeration Types (SMB, SNMP, LDAP)
- Tools: Nmap, Nikto, Netcat, enum4linux
- Reconnaissance - What it is and why it is needed?
- Active and Passive Reconnaissance - Difference
- WHOIS
- DNS - Domain Registrars, How to get domain details from whois queries
- Regional Internet Registries(RIRs - Five RIRs, How to get IP details from whois queries
- Enumerating People - Facebook, Linkedin, Twitter, Job portals (what information about people can be collected from these sites)
- DNS lookups - Name lookups, DNS record types (A, AAAA, MX, NS, SOA, CNAME, PTR), Zone Transfer
- Shodan, Google Dorking
- OSINT Techniques
- Lab Scenarios: Finding Subdomains, Leaked Credentials
- Tools: Recon-ng, Maltego, theHarvester, Shodan CLI
- Password Cracking Techniques
- Windows and Linux Privilege Escalation
- Exploit Introduction
- Lab Setup: Metasploitable, Windows VM
- Tools: Hydra, John the Ripper, Metasploit Framework
- Common Malware Types and Behaviors
- Basics of Reverse Shells
- Lab Scenarios: Detecting Simple Malware Using Open-Source Tools
- Tools: YARA, ClamAV, Cuckoo Sandbox (intro only)
- Types: TCP/IP Hijacking, Application-Level
- Understanding Session Cookies and Tokens
- Mitigation Techniques
- Lab Scenarios: Using Wireshark and MITM tools in controlled lab
- Tools: Ettercap, Wireshark
- Evasion Techniques: Packet Fragmentation, Encryption, Polymorphic Shellcode
- Honeypot Awareness and Detection
- Lab Setup: Suricata IDS, Snort
- Tools: hping3, Nmap Advanced Options
- Psychology of Social Engineering
- Phishing Email Techniques
- Pretexting and Impersonation
- Mitigation Techniques
- Lab Scenarios: Phishing Simulators
- Tools: Social-Engineer Toolkit (SET)
- OWASP Top 10 Overview
- SQL Injection
- Cross-Site Scripting (XSS)
- Directory Traversal, CSRF Basics
- Lab Setup: OWASP Juice Shop, DVWA
- Tools: Burp Suite Community, SQLMap
- WiFi Authentication and Encryption Basics
- WPA/WPA2 Attacks (Theory and Practice)
- Rogue AP Setup Awareness
- Tools: Aircrack-ng, Wireshark
- Android and iOS Security Models
- Mobile App Vulnerabilities (Top 10 Overview)
- Lab Setup: Android Emulator with MobSF
- Tools: MobSF, Drozer
- Cloud Computing Overview
- IaaS, PaaS, SaaS
- Basics of AWS, Azure, GCP Security Considerations
- Container Technology Basics: Docker, Kubernetes Intro
- Misconfiguration Examples
- Lab Scenarios: Local Docker Lab
- Tools: kube-hunter, kube-bench
- Symmetric vs. Asymmetric Encryption
- Hashing Algorithms
- Real-world Application in Secure Protocols
- Lab Setup: Hash Cracking Basics
- Tools: Hashcat, OpenSSL CLI
- Common Vulnerabilities: CVEs
- Exploit Framework Usage
- Exploit Writing Basics
- Tools: Metasploit, Exploit-DB
- Writing Effective Pentest Reports
- Legal Considerations
- Client Communication and Remediation Planning

Taking a DevOps course can equip you with essential skills in automation, continuous integration/continuous deployment (CI/CD), cloud computing, and collaboration tools. It prepares you for roles in the rapidly growing field of IT, where companies are increasingly adopting DevOps practices to improve efficiency and reduce time-to-market for their products.
Yes, many organizations offer certifications upon completion of their DevOps courses. Common certifications include Certified Kubernetes Administrator (CKA), AWS Certified DevOps Engineer - Professional, and Certified Jenkins Engineer.
Completing a DevOps course can open up various career paths such as: DevOps Engineer, Site Reliability Engineer (SRE), Automation Architect, Release Manager, Cloud Engineer
Key tools commonly used in the field include: Version Control: Git, CI/CD Tools: Jenkins, Containerization: Docker, Orchestration: Kubernetes, Configuration Management: Ansible, Chef Monitoring Tools: Prometheus, Grafana Learning these tools will significantly enhance your ability to implement effective DevOps practices.
Cloud computing provides the infrastructure needed for rapid deployment and scalability that aligns well with the principles of DevOps. Many organizations leverage cloud services like AWS or Azure to facilitate CI/CD pipelines and manage resources efficiently.
